WebTo calculate watts for a LED light, you'll want to multiply the current (measured in amps) by the voltage (measured in volts). The best way to get an accurate read on amps and volts is to look at the packaging of your lightbulb. From there, you can calculate kilowatts by multiplying amps and volts and dividing by 1000. Web21 nov. 2024 · Efficiency: The efficiency of any light bulb is the amount of light it emits compared to the amount of power it uses. It is the lumens divided by the watts or the lumens per watt. Once you’ve got the lumens and the watts, you can calculate the efficiency. It probably won’t be printed on the package.
